INTERFACIAL STRENGTHES OF GLASS FIBER REINFORCED THERMOPLASTICCOMPOSITES AND ITS EFFECTS ON MECHANICAL PROPERTIES
|
Abstract:
Interfacial characteristics and effects on material properties as well as controllingof interfacial bonds were studied in the systems of BK-10 glass fiber reinforced PMMA and PCthermoplastic composites.Coating the fibers with organosilane coupling agents improves theinterfacial bonds and thus the mechanical properties of the composites.Four interfacial failuremodes exist in systems of brittle and ductile matrices with strong and weak interfacial bondsrespectively.Optical transparent composites can be made in systems with matching refractiveindices of matrix and reinforcing fiber by proper process controll.
